Physician Assistant Salary in Sherwood, OR: $144,561 (2026)
Quick Answer:A full-time physician assistant in Sherwood, OR earns a median $144,561/year (≈ $69.50/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 29-1071). Once you factor in Sherwood's price level (3% above national, BEA RPP 102.6), that paycheck buys what $140,898 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 5.2% below the Oregon state average.

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Sherwood metropolitan area, the median physician assistant salary grew 21.0% from $115,594 (2019) to $139,916 (2025). At a 3.32%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$149,361 by 2027 — a total increase of $33,767 (29.21%) from 2019.
Note: Historical values (2019–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Sherwood met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 3.32%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Actual salaries may vary based on employer, experience, certifications, and local market conditions.

Physician Assistant Job Market in Sherwood
Analyzing Sherwood's job market reveals that there are only four physician assistants currently employed, which can lead to unique opportunities as demand outpaces supply. The cost-of-living index sits at 102.6, slightly above the national average, impacting take-home purchasing power for local practitioners. Within Sherwood, the highest salaries are typically found in surgical specialty practices, particularly orthopedics and cardiothoracic surgery, often benefiting from first-assist billing structures. Factors like call coverage, RVU productivity bonuses, and the differences between hospital employment and private practice arrangements contribute to the significant variation in compensation. To maximize earning potential, PAs should consider specializing in higher-paying fields, actively build relationships with hospitals and surgical groups, and keep abreast of local healthcare trends influencing demand.
